Things I Checked for Compatibility
One of the first things I verified was whether my device supported a 2.5-inch SATA drive. I also made sure I had the right mounting space and cable connections if I was using it in a desktop. For laptops, I checked the drive thickness and whether my system could clone the existing drive or needed a fresh installation.
